Split pea with ham soup, prepared with water or ready-to-serve, reduced sodium, canned contains 167 calories per 245 g serving. This serving contains 1.7 g of fat, 9.8 g of protein and 28 g of carbohydrate. The latter is 3.9 g sugar and 4.7 g of dietary fiber, the rest is complex carbohydrate. Split pea with ham soup, prepared with water or ready-to-serve, reduced sodium, canned contains 0.7 g of saturated fat and 7.4 mg of cholesterol per serving. 245 g of Split pea with ham soup, prepared with water or ready-to-serve, reduced sodium, canned contains 51.45 mcg vitamin A, 2.5 mg vitamin C, 0.00 mcg vitamin D as well as 1.72 mg of iron, 39.20 mg of calcium, 500 mg of potassium. Split pea with ham soup, prepared with water or ready-to-serve, reduced sodium, canned belong to 'Soups, Sauces, and Gravies' food category.
